Learning outcomes

After successful completion of the course, students are able to:

  • define objectives of condition monitoring of machines and systems
  • detect faults in the running behaviour of machines
  • create reliable error diagnoses
  • identify and eliminate the root causes of failures and malfunctions
  • apply analytical procedures for error assessment
  • design holistic monitoring strategies using AI approaches
  • apply modern concepts like PHM (Prognostics and Health Management)

Subject of course

Maintenance management methodology and techniques; physical and technical failure characteristics; vibration fundamentals for root cause analysis; fault descriptors on rotors, bearings and gears; corrective measures and proactive improvements; holistic maintenance systems using AI methods; prescriptive approaches.New maintenance management concepts such as Prognostics and Health Management will also be introduced.
